What is uPVC?
uPVC, or unplasticized polyvinyl chloride, is a rigid plastic product understood for its strength and durability. Unlike routine PVC, it does not consist of plasticizers, making it harder and more stable. This product is extensively utilized in construction due to its low upkeep requirements, resistance to weather conditions, and long-lasting nature.
uPVC windows and doors have become progressively popular for domestic and business residential or commercial properties due to the fact that of their aesthetic appeal, energy efficiency, and cost-effectiveness. They offer an exceptional option to standard products like wood, steel, or aluminum.
Benefits of uPVC Doors and Windows
Resilience
Among the standout functions of uPVC is its resilience. uPVC doors and windows are resistant to rust, rot, and rust, making them ideal for all climates. Unlike wood, they aren't affected by wetness and pest invasions, and they can withstand extreme sunshine without deforming or tarnishing.
Low Maintenance
Unlike wood doors and windows that need routine polishing or aluminum frames that may corrode, uPVC products need extremely little upkeep. Cleaning them with an easy fabric and mild detergent suffices to keep them looking as excellent as new.
Energy Efficiency
uPVC doors and windows are outstanding insulators. They help maintain indoor temperature levels, making them energy-efficient and reducing cooling and heating expenses. Their thermal insulation homes make them a preferred choice in both hot and cold climates.
Economical
uPVC items are usually more budget friendly than aluminum or wooden equivalents, both in regards to upfront expense and upkeep expenses. Their durability and minimal maintenance requirements likewise contribute to their total cost-efficiency.
Eco-Friendly
The production of uPVC includes less energy resources compared to other materials. Furthermore, uPVC is recyclable, that makes it an ecologically friendly option.
Noise Reduction
The excellent sealing on uPVC doors and windows significantly minimizes external sound, making them a fantastic option for city homes or locations with heavy traffic.
Security
Modern uPVC windows and doors come with multi-point locking systems, improving the security of your home. The material's strength and resistance to require make it difficult for intruders to damage.
Visual Flexibility
uPVC windows and doors are offered in a wide variety of colors, designs, and finishes, making it easy to match them with the design and design of your home.
Common Types of uPVC Doors and Windows
Whether you're wanting to illuminate your interiors or optimize energy performance, there is no shortage of designs available in uPVC. Here are some common types to think about:
uPVC Doors
Sash Doors
Popular for their simplicity, sash doors are hinged on one side and open outwards or inwards. They are best for patio areas, balconies, or garden entrances.
Sliding Doors
These doors run on a sliding mechanism and are perfect for areas where a swing-out door would use up too much room. Sliding uPVC doors are best for contemporary interiors and large glass panels.
French Doors
Understood for their classic appeal, French doors featured 2 panels that open outwards from the center. They include a classy and outdoor feel to any space.
Sliding & Folding Doors
For those who choose a modern visual and versatility, sliding and folding uPVC doors are an excellent option. windows and doors replacement permit larger openings and are best for connecting indoor and outside areas.
uPVC Windows
Sash Windows
These are depended upon one side and open outside, offering exceptional ventilation and unblocked views.
Sliding Windows
Perfect for smaller sized areas, sliding windows glide horizontally along a track and are easy to run.
Bay and Bow Windows
For a touch of high-end, bay and bow windows job outside from the primary wall, producing extra space and allowing sufficient sunshine.
Tilt and Turn Windows

A versatile option, these windows tilt inward for ventilation and turn fully open for cleaning and fire escape.
Set Windows
Ideal for areas that do not need ventilation, fixed windows provide great insulation and enable plenty of natural light.
